Louise Tutterow Gunter, 90, of Courtney, died at Mountain Valley Hospice Home in Yadkinville Friday, May 18, 2018.

She was born in Davie County on May 2, 1928; daughter of the late Robert and Nina Richardson Tutterow. She was married to Moyer H. Gunter, the love of her life. She was of the Baptist faith and loved her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. She retired from Sara Lee Corp. after 28 years.  She was employed for Yadkin County Schools (Courtney and Forbush High) with the cafeteria staff. She enjoyed working in her yard and growing flowers, cooking and was known for her fruit and red velvet cakes. She loved spending time with family, friends and close neighbors.
